PIC16F18044 : PIC16F18015/25/44/45 PIC16F18015/25/44/45 Full-Featured, 8/14/20-Pin Microcontrollers Introduction The PIC16F180 microcontroller family has a suite of digital and analog peripherals that enable cost-sensitive sensor and real-time control applications. This product family is available from 8 to 44-pin packages in a memory range of 3.5 KB to 28 KB, with speeds up to 32 MHz. The family includes a 10-bit Analog-to-Digital Converter with Computation (ADCC), automated Capacitive Voltage Divider (CVD) techniques for advanced capacitive touch sensing, an 8-bit Digital-to-Analog Converter (DAC) module, and many more waveform control and communication peripherals.
